Error Message Print Unable ## Registration Replace Toner Replace WT Box Screen Init. Fail Self-Diagnostic Short paper Size Error Cause Action The machine has a mechanical problem. • Press and hold to turn off the machine, wait a few minutes, and then turn it on again. • If the problem continues, contact Brother Customer Service. Contact Brother Customer Service at: 1-877-BROTHER (1-877-276-8437) (in USA) www.brother.ca/support (in Canada) or to locate a Brother Authorized Service Center, visit: www.brother-usa.com/service Registration failed. • Press and hold down to turn off the machine. Wait a few seconds, and then turn it on again. Perform the color registration again using the LCD. • Install a new belt unit. • If the problem continues, contact Brother Customer Service or your local Brother dealer. The toner cartridge is at the end of Replace the toner cartridge for the color its life. The machine stops all print indicated on the LCD. operations. See Related Information: Replace the Toner Cartridge. It is time to replace the waste toner box. Replace the waste toner box with a new one. See Related Information: Replace the Waste Toner Box. The touchscreen was pressed before the power on initialization was completed. Make sure nothing is touching the touchscreen. Debris may be stuck between the Insert a piece of stiff paper between the lower lower part of the touchscreen and part of the touchscreen and its frame and slide its frame. it back and forth to push out any debris. The temperature of the fuser unit does not rise to a specified temperature within the specified time. The fuser unit is too hot. Press and hold to turn off the machine, wait a few seconds, and then turn it on again. Leave the machine idle for 15 minutes with the power on. The length of the paper in the tray is too short for the machine to deliver it to the Face down output tray. Open the back cover (Face up output tray) to let the printed page exit onto the Face up output tray. Remove the printed pages, and then press Retry. The paper size defined in the printer driver is not supported by the defined tray. Choose a paper size supported by the defined tray. 217
